**智慧農場系統開發是一個集成了現代信息技術、物聯網、大數據和人工智能等技術的綜合性信息系統,旨在提高農業生產效率和管理水平**。智慧農場系統的開發需要整合多種技術和資源,從不同角度出發來實現農業生產的智能化管理。以下是具體分析:
1. **技術選型**
- **Java+SpringBoot+Vue+Node.js**:利用Java語言結合SpringBoot框架進行后端開發,前端則使用Vue.js框架,并通過Node.js處理服務端的異步通信[^1^]。這種技術棧能夠實現前后端分離,提高系統的靈活性和可維護性。
- **物聯網技術**:通過ESP32主控板連接各種傳感器(如溫濕度傳感器、光敏電阻傳感器、土壤濕度傳感器等),采集農作物生長環境參數,并利用MQTT協議將數據傳輸到云平臺[^3^]。物聯網技術使得實時數據采集成為可能,為后續的分析與決策提供基礎。
- **數據庫管理**:使用MySQL等數據庫管理系統存儲和管理農場相關數據[^2^][^3^]。數據庫的設計和維護是智慧農場系統的重要組成部分,確保數據的完整性和可靠性。
2. **功能模塊設計**
- **用戶管理**:包括登錄驗證、用戶信息管理等功能[^1^]。這是系統的基礎模塊,保證只有授權用戶才能訪問系統,保護數據安全。
- **農場信息管理**:展示農場基本信息,如地塊檔案、種植計劃、生產資料等[^1^]。這些信息幫助管理者了解農場現狀和規劃未來生產活動。
- **數據分析與預警管理**:通過對采集的數據進行分析,生成圖表和報表,為決策提供支持[^1^]。同時,根據分析結果進行預警管理,及時通知管理者采取相應措施。
- **設備遠程控制**:通過Web端或微信小程序端遠程控制農業設備,如水泵、風扇等,以調整作物生長環境[^3^]。
- **財務信息管理**:記錄和管理農產品的銷售數據、成本計算及收入統計,實現經濟效益大化[^2^]。
3. **系統架構**
- **分層架構設計**:采用分層架構設計,將系統分為表示層、業務邏輯層和數據訪問層,每層之間通過清晰定義的接口進行通信[^2^]。這種結構有助于降低各層之間的依賴,便于單獨開發和測試。
- **微服務架構**:考慮將大型復雜的系統拆分成多個小型、獨立的服務,每個服務負責單一的功能模塊[^4^]。微服務架構提高了系統的可擴展性和容錯能力。
4. **用戶體驗優化**
- **界面設計**:采用現代化的UI/UX設計理念,使操作界面簡潔直觀[^1^]。例如,使用圖表和折線圖展示環境參數,方便用戶快速獲取信息。
- **多端訪問**:支持Web端和微信小程序端訪問,提高系統的可訪問性和便利性[^3^]。用戶可以通過手機隨時隨地查看農場狀態和控制設備。
5. **安全性與穩定性**
- **數據安全**:采用加密傳輸、身份驗證和權限控制等手段保護數據安全[^2^]。防止未授權訪問和數據泄露。
- **系統穩定性**:通過負載均衡、冗余備份和故障轉移機制確保系統的高可用性[^4^]。即使部分組件失效,整個系統仍能正常運行。
智慧農場系統的開發不僅涉及多種技術的綜合應用,還包括對農業生產流程的深入理解和用戶體驗的優化。通過科學的數據收集、分析和決策支持,智慧農場系統顯著提升了農業生產的智能化水平,為現代農業提供了一種高效、精細化的管理方案。
- 廣告聯盟對接小游戲app系統開發案例 2024-12-05
- 成人用品商城app系統開發案例 2024-12-05
- 知識付費app系統開發案例 2024-12-05
- 手機租賃小程序系統開發案例 2024-12-05
- 相親交友app平臺系統開發案例 2024-12-05
- 靈活用工平臺系統開發案例 2024-12-05
- 短視頻app直播一對一系統開發案例 2024-12-05
- 任務懸賞 、裂變分傭、任務分布系統開發案例 2024-12-05
- 上門預約按摩小程序app系統開發案例 2024-12-05
- 游戲陪玩app平臺系統開發案例 2024-12-05
- 健身房預約小程序系統開發案例 2024-12-05
- 蝸米商城app平臺模式系統開案例發 2024-12-05
- 課程預約小程序系統開發案例 2024-12-05
- 天天友伴app平臺系統開發案例 2024-12-05
- 心理咨詢小程序系統開發案例 2024-12-05
聯系方式
- 聯系電話:未提供
- 經理:潘經理
- 手 機:13794320625
- 微 信:l456299